码迷,mamicode.com
首页 > 数据库
centos web+mysql服务器的安全
今天闲来无事,拿来X-Scan-v3.3来扫描自己的服务器,开放端口有22,80,443,3306;3306端口被扫出来,呵呵,那可不得了;一,屏蔽扫描器扫出3306端口,因为web和数据库是在同一台服务器上,就没有必要打开远程连接数据库,操作如下; 1.1 在配置文件/etc/my.cnf中,修....
分类:数据库   时间:2014-05-29 09:15:45    阅读次数:292
c# + Sql server 事务处理
事务(Transaction)是并发控制的单位,是用户定义的一个操作序列。这些操作要么都做,要么都不做,是一个不可分割的工作单位。通过事务,SQL Server能将逻辑相关的一组操作绑定在一起,以便服务器保持数据的完整性。在sql server+ .net 开发环境下,有两种方法能够完成事务的...
分类:数据库   时间:2014-05-29 09:33:19    阅读次数:365
SQL Server 动态行转列(参数化表名、分组列、行转列字段、字段值)
原文:SQL Server 动态行转列(参数化表名、分组列、行转列字段、字段值)一.本文所涉及的内容(Contents)本文所涉及的内容(Contents)背景(Contexts)实现代码(SQL Codes)方法一:使用拼接SQL,静态列字段;方法二:使用拼接SQL,动态列字段;方法三:使用PIV...
分类:数据库   时间:2014-05-29 09:32:15    阅读次数:438
Mysql Join语法解析与性能分析
原文:Mysql Join语法解析与性能分析一.Join语法概述join 用于多表中字段之间的联系,语法如下:... FROM table1 INNER|LEFT|RIGHT JOIN table2 ON conditionatable1:左表;table2:右表。JOIN 按照功能大致分为如下三类...
分类:数据库   时间:2014-05-29 10:33:54    阅读次数:735
SQL Server 监控统计阻塞脚本信息
数据库产生阻塞(Blocking)的本质原因 :SQL语句连续持有锁的时间过长 ,数目过多, 粒度过大。阻塞是事务隔离带来的副作用,它是不可避免的,而且是一个数据库系统常见的现象。 但是阻塞的时间和出现频率要控制在一定的范围内,阻塞持续的时间过长或阻塞出现过多(过于频繁),就会对数据库性能产生严重的...
分类:数据库   时间:2014-05-29 10:46:10    阅读次数:616
mysql官方的HA中间件
mysql官方的HA中间件http://www.mysql.com/products/enterprise/fabric.htmlMySQL Fabric is an extensible framework for managing farms of MySQL Servers. Two feat...
分类:数据库   时间:2014-05-29 10:50:17    阅读次数:695
为具有端口 "50000" 的服务名称 "db2c_DB2" 而更新系统上的服务文件时出错
转载:http://blog.csdn.net/leo6159/article/details/7936725安装DB2(V9.1)To work around this issue, follow these steps:Run the following DB2 command from the...
分类:数据库   时间:2014-05-29 11:02:39    阅读次数:638
数据库一对一的两种关联 主键关联和外键关联
关联映射:一对一一对一关系就如球队与球队所在地址之间的关系,一支球队仅有一个地址,而一个地址区也仅有一支球队。数据表间一对一关系的表现有两种,一种是外键关联,一种是主键关联。图示如下:一对一外键关联:一对一主键关联:要求两个表的主键必须完全一致,通过两个表的主键建立关联关系出自:http://hi....
分类:数据库   时间:2014-05-29 11:51:23    阅读次数:586
CentOS环境下yum安装LAMP(Linux+Apache+Mysql+php)
同样的网站程序在Linux下运行要比在windows下快出不少,所以决定使用Linux的发行版CentOS ,本文主要讲解在CentOS下使用yum命令 安装LAMP详细过程。我们使用的软件是CentOS的最新版本CentOS 6.3,其他版本的也基本类似。第一步:更新系统内核(如果不想更新可以跳过...
分类:数据库   时间:2014-05-29 12:04:36    阅读次数:386
Oracle Parameter使用
string sqlStr = "update sys_case t set t.content =:CONTENT,t.property=:PROPERTY where id=:ID"; OracleParameter[] parameterValue = { ...
分类:数据库   时间:2014-05-29 12:18:04    阅读次数:283
SQL /LINQ/Lamda
SQLLINQLambdaSELECT *FROM HumanResources.Employeefrom e in Employeesselect eEmployees .Select (e => e)SELECT e.LoginID, e.JobTitleFROM HumanResources....
分类:数据库   时间:2014-05-29 12:24:05    阅读次数:317
SQL-----DML
DML---Data Manipulation Language数据操纵语言命令能使用户能够查询数据库以及操作已由数据库中的数据.insert,delete update selectDCL(Data Control Language)数据控制语言,用来设置或更改数据库用户或角色权限,控制数据库操作...
分类:数据库   时间:2014-05-29 13:02:35    阅读次数:274
Mysql中自增字段(AUTO_INCREMENT)的一些常识
Mysql中自增字段(AUTO_INCREMENT)的一些常识在系统开发过程中,我们经常要用到唯一编号。使用过mysql的人都应该知道,mysql有一个定义列为自增的属性:AUTO_INCREMENT。指定了AUTO_INCREMENT的列必须要建索引,不然会报错,索引可以为主键索引,当然也可以为非...
分类:数据库   时间:2014-05-29 12:59:30    阅读次数:573
IOT/Abort trap(coredump) oracle10g rac asm aix5错误
起因:两台ibm 小型机搭建的oracle10g rac环境,使用asm磁盘组,运行了多年没有问题,今天机房要计划停电,正常关机后,开机后数据库节点1无法自动启动,使用ps -ef |grep d.bin查看,有crs进程。但是使用crs_stat -t 命令查看,报IOT/Abort trap(c...
分类:数据库   时间:2014-05-30 09:30:23    阅读次数:394
利用接口实现多种数据库类型的灵活更换
当存在可能要更换数据库类型的时候,要考虑两个问题:一,不同类型的数据库命名空间不一样,用到的函数名也不一样,尽管很相似;二,有些SQL语句在不一样的数据库之间是不通用的!那么要在更换数据库类型的时候,如何做到尽量少受因为上面两点而造成的影响呢?!利用接口,可以将第一点的影响降到最低!至于第二点, 可...
分类:数据库   时间:2014-05-30 09:31:43    阅读次数:344
使用SQL命令手动写入Discuz帖子内容
-- 转存表中的数据`forum_post`INSERT INTO `forum_post` (`pid`, `fid`,`tid`, `first`, `author`, `authorid`, `subject`, `dateline`, `message`,`useip`, `invisibl...
分类:数据库   时间:2014-05-30 09:58:50    阅读次数:348
sqljdbc.jar 和 sqljdbc4.jar
从微软官网下载的Sql server2008的JDBC jar包,解压后里面有两个jar包(sqljdbc.jar 和 sqljdbc4.jar)。到底应该用哪个呢?地址:http://www.microsoft.com/downloads/details.aspx?FamilyID=a737000...
分类:数据库   时间:2014-05-30 10:51:18    阅读次数:363
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!